More about Social Work courses

If you’re looking to jumpstart your career in the field of social work, you will find a plethora of opportunities in Waterloo, Australia. With a total of 56 Social Work courses available, aspiring professionals can choose from various training pathways tailored to their interests and career goals. Whether you’re interested in Youth Work, Mental Health, or Community Management, Waterloo offers numerous options to suit your needs.

Several local training providers are available to offer you hands-on learning experiences right in the heart of Waterloo. Institutions such as Wesley Vocational Institute, which teaches the Certificate IV in Mental Health, and The University of Sydney, offering a Bachelor of Social Work, provide face-to-face education. Additionally, you can explore courses from 3Bridges Training and Education for the Certificate IV in Leisure and Health and NBMC for the Certificate III in Allied Health Assistance. This local presence makes it easier for students to engage directly with instructors and peers.

Waterloo caters not only to traditional social work pathways but also to niche areas such as Alcohol and Other Drugs, Aged Care, and Disability. Training providers like AHHI and Star Training Academy deliver relevant courses that will equip you with the necessary skills to thrive in these sectors. With training opportunities like the Certificate II in Active Volunteering from The Centre for Volunteering, you can start making a difference in your community while building your resume.
